I’m not sure about other cultures but from what I know most Asians have this “postpartum” care month, it’s called 坐月子, in mandarin, literal translates into “sitting the month”. Traditionally, mothers or mother in laws will help the new mother and her baby for the 30 days to help the new mom rest and recover. The baby is taken care of and so is the mom with a postpartum menu that caters to help recovery.

For those that don’t have family to help, we could also hire postpartum nannies that do that. Postpartum care centres are also getting popular and I had the luxury of experiencing it twice with both my children.

You also get to learn on how to care for your newborn which is essential to new parents.
